Java爬虫玩转朋友圈,解锁丰富多彩内容!
优采云 发布时间: 2023-04-09 06:09随着社交网络的发展,人们越来越依赖于社交媒体来获取信息和与朋友互动。然而,有些时候我们会觉得朋友圈的内容过于单一,缺乏新鲜感。那么,有没有什么方法可以让我们在朋友圈中获取更多有趣的信息呢?答案是:使用Java爬虫!
下面我们将从以下10个方面详细介绍如何使用Java爬虫来获取丰富多彩的朋友圈内容。
1.确定目标网站
首先,我们需要确定要爬取的目标网站。比如,我们可以选择微信公众号或者微博等社交平台。
2.分析网站结构
在确定了目标网站之后,我们需要对其进行结构分析。这包括了解网站的页面结构、URL规则、数据格式等等。
3.编写代码
根据对目标网站的分析结果,我们可以开始编写Java爬虫代码。在编写代码时,需要注意遵守相关法律法规和道德规范。
4.选择合适的爬虫框架
Java爬虫框架有很多,比如Jsoup、HttpClient、WebMagic等等。我们需要根据自己的需求选择合适的框架。
5.确定爬取策略
在编写爬虫代码时,需要确定爬取策略。例如,我们可以选择按照时间顺序爬取朋友圈内容,或者按照点赞数进行排序。
6.设置请求头信息
在发送HTTP请求时,需要设置请求头信息。这包括浏览器类型、Cookie信息、Referer等等。
7.解析HTML页面
在获取到网页内容后,需要对其进行解析。我们可以使用Jsoup等工具来解析HTML页面,并提取所需数据。
8.存储数据
在获取到数据后,需要将其存储到数据库或者文件中。这样我们就可以方便地对数据进行分析和处理。
9.处理异常情况
在爬取过程中,可能会遇到一些异常情况,比如网络连接超时、页面不存在等等。我们需要在代码中加入相应的处理逻辑,以保证程序的稳定性和可靠性。
10.遵守相关法律法规和道德规范
最后,我们需要遵守相关法律法规和道德规范。在进行任何爬虫活动时,都应该遵守相关规定,不得侵犯他人的合法权益。
通过使用Java爬虫,我们可以轻松地获取朋友圈中的各种有趣内容,比如朋友们的动态、热门话题等等。当然,在进行任何爬虫活动时,都需要遵守相关法律法规和道德规范。如果你想了解更多关于Java爬虫的知识,可以访问优采云网站(www.ucaiyun.com),了解更多有关SEO优化和网络营销的知识。